Anesthesiologists in The United States
(Anestesiólogos)
Anesthesiologists -- Administer anesthetics during surgery or other medical procedures.
SOC (Standard Occupational Classification) | 29-1061.00 |
Career Interests | IRS |
Minimum education required | (Doctoral) Doctoral or professional degree |
Minimum work experience required | (None) None |
Job training required | (Internship) Internship/residency |
Growth Outlook (projected percentage growth in jobs per year from 2018-2028) | 0.43 (low growth) |
Current number of workers in USA (2018) | 34,500 |
Projected number of workers in USA (2028) | 36,000 |
Average Annual Openings in USA (2018-2028) | 1,200 |
